#include <iostream>
using namespace std;

struct Node
{
int data;
Node* next;
};

struct List
{
Node* head;
int length;
};

int main()
{
List L;
L.head = nullptr;
L.length = 0;

int n;
cin >> n;

Node *current = nullptr;

for (int i = 0; i < n; i++)
{
int data;
cin >> data;

Node *newNode = new Node;
newNode->data = data;
newNode->next = nullptr;

if (L.head == nullptr)
{
L.head = newNode;
current = newNode;
} else
{
current->next = newNode;
current = newNode;
}

L.length++;
}

int m;
cin >> m;

for (int i = 0; i < m; i++)
{
int op, k;
cin >> op >> k;

if (op == 0)
{
int d;
cin >> d;

if (k < 0 || k > L.length)
{
continue;
}

Node *newNode = new Node;
newNode->data = d;

if (k == 0)
{
newNode->next = L.head;
L.head = newNode;
}
else
{
Node *prev = L.head;
for (int j = 0; j < k - 1; j++)
{
prev = prev->next;
}
newNode->next = prev->next;
prev->next = newNode;
}

L.length++;
}
else if (op == 1)
{
if (k <= 0 || k > L.length)
{
continue;
}

Node *prev = nullptr;
Node *curr = L.head;

for (int j = 0; j < k - 1; j++)
{
prev = curr;
curr = curr->next;
}

if (prev == nullptr)
{
L.head = curr->next;
} else
{
prev->next = curr->next;
}

delete curr;
L.length--;
}
}

// 输出链表
Node *curr = L.head;
while (curr != nullptr)
{
cout << curr->data << " ";
curr = curr->next;
}

// 释放链表内存
curr = L.head;
while (curr != nullptr)
{
Node *temp = curr;
curr = curr->next;
delete temp;
}

return 0;
}
